Associate Director, Omnichannel Marketing, CRC
BioSpace
Job Description The Digital Marketing, Associate Director is responsible for overseeing digital marketing strategies and initiatives to enhance product appeal and performance. This role involves developing and implementing digital marketing plans, optimizing online presence, and leading teams to achieve marketing objectives.
Objectives / Purpose
The Omnichannel HCP Lead, CRC will lead the development and implementation of the Omnichannel plan for the CRC HCP customers.
They design and deploy the customer HCP Omnichannel experience plan for different personas and at various adoption levels.
They collaborate with multiple cross-functional partners to design, build and deploy best‑in‑class Omnichannel campaigns.
They drive meaningful engagement with HCP segments to drive impact through promotional mix analyses.
They lead HCP media strategy with agency and partners and rigorously track performance.
They analyze customer behavior using CRM data and track HCP engagement, leading the HCP Experience Measurement Plan.
Accountabilities
Defines vision, strategy and implementation of HCP omnichannel solutions.
Partners with brand team and partners to identify HCP targets and designs personalized campaigns.
Creates agile content and implements initiatives across web, SEO/SEM, email, direct mail, social media and digital advertising.
In partnership with agencies identifies trends and insights to optimize customer plans.
Implements identified technologies.
Utilizes audience research and trend analysis to develop modular, personalized content.
Establishes key objectives and performance metrics for omnichannel campaigns.
Works cross‑functionally to align strategy with HCP segments.
Drives improvements in financial performance of campaigns through analysis and process improvements.
Actively manages agency partner relationships, budgeting and contract reviews.
Required Education, Behavioral Competencies and Skills
Bachelor’s degree
8+ years of experience with increasing responsibilities in digital agency, marketing, or related function, preferably with pharma or healthcare industry experience
Deep understanding of multichannel marketing tactics and digital channels
Demonstrated experience leveraging customer journeys and experience maps
Experience managing agencies of record to develop and execute marketing tactics on time and within budget
Experience with A/B testing across channels and content types
Strong analytical skills with ability to assess business results and define KPIs
Proven experience advising stakeholders and influencing business partners
Demonstrated ability to learn new market, disease states and products quickly
Strong consultative skillset including discovery, business analysis, workshop facilitation, roadmap planning and project management
Ability to influence and persuade stakeholders at all levels and across departments
Self‑motivated drive to work collaboratively with multiple business units
Financial management and budgeting abilities
Additional Information Percentage of travel: approximately 10% travel. Willingness to travel to various meetings, conferences and could include overnight.
Compensation And Benefits Summary U.S. Base Salary Range: $153,600.00 – $241,340.00. U.S. based employees may be eligible for short‑term and/or long‑term incentives and a range of benefits including medical, dental, vision, 401(k), disability coverage and more.
